Post-Scrapy Odyssey: 5 New Horizons to Discover
Introduction
Scrapy is a powerful and versatile open-source web scraping library in Python. After mastering the ins and outs of this potent tool, you may wonder what's next. This article serves as a roadmap to the five objectives you should target after becoming proficient in Scrapy. Each goal is presented along with its encompassing description, strategy for achievement, an affirmation phrase to foster a positive mindset, and a visualization scenario to grasp the potential outcome.
Goal 1: Exploring Automated Web Testing
Description: After mastering Scrapy, a natural progression is diving into the associated area of automated web testing to ensure the quality of web applications.
Primary Strategy: Learning popular automation testing frameworks like Selenium and understanding how to create automated test cases for various web applications.
Action Roadmap: Scrapy Masters’ Evolution: 5 Steps to a Progressive Automated Web Testing Journey
Affirmation: "I am skilled with automated web testing, ensuring high-quality and reliable web applications."
Visualization: Picture yourself using Selenium to automate a complex test case sequence that your web applications pass flawlessly, boosting user satisfaction.
Goal 2: Leveraging Machine Learning for Web Scraping
Description: Use machine learning techniques to enhance the effectiveness of your web scraping tasks, such as intelligent content extraction and categorization.
Primary Strategy: Studying how machine learning can be applied to web scraping, with a focus on techniques like natural language processing and text classification.
Action Roadmap: Scrapy Savants Unite: 5 Steps to Harnessing Machine Learning in Web Scraping
Affirmation: "I am adept at applying machine learning to web scraping, bringing enhanced intelligence to data extraction tasks."
Visualization: Imagine a scraper you've built that not only extracts data but also classifies it into meaningful categories, greatly improving usability.
Goal 3: Diving into Deep Learning for NLP
Description: With the text data obtained from web scraping, you can now delve into the world of deep learning for natural language processing (NLP).
Primary Strategy: Learning about advanced deep learning techniques, understanding architectures like Recurrent Neural Networks (RNNs), and applying them in NLP projects.
Action Roadmap: Deep Learning Exploration: 5-Step Master Plan for Harnessing NLP with Scrapy Proficiency
Affirmation: "I am proficient in Deep Learning for NLP, producing state-of-the-art models that understand human language."
Visualization: Envision a sentiment analysis model developed by you using deep learning, providing accurate results that significantly elevate an analytics project.
Goal 4: Owning Data Analysis Techniques
Description: To make the most out of scraped data, it is essential to understand and apply advanced data analysis techniques.
Primary Strategy: Mastering concepts of data visualization, statistical analysis, and data manipulation, deciding which techniques to apply using libraries such as Pandas and NumPy.
Action Roadmap: Data Analysis Mastery: 5-Stage Blueprint for Enhancing Analysis Skills for Scrapy Experts
Affirmation: "I am versed in using advanced data analysis techniques, taking raw data, and transforming it into valuable insights."
Visualization: Visualize yourself interpreting a complex dataset using sophisticated data analysis techniques, and realizing valuable insights that determine successful business decisions.
Goal 5: Mastering Large Scale Data Processes
Description: Dealing with the big data generated by intense web scraping activities is an essential skill, ensuring efficient processes and manageable outputs.
Primary Strategy: Learning about big data technologies like Hadoop or Spark, understanding how they work, and implementing them to manage large-scale web scraping projects.
Action Roadmap: Mastering Big Data: 5 Steps to Conquer Large-Scale Data for Scrapy Pros
Affirmation: "I am proficient in Big Data technologies, confidently managing and manipulating large datasets for maximum outcomes."
Visualization: Imagine yourself managing an enormous web scraping project, smoothly processing and storing the data using big-data technologies with ease and efficiency.
Comments
Post a Comment